The liveliest areas are Trastevere, Monti, Testaccio, Campo de’ Fiori and San Lorenzo, each with its own mix of bars, rooftops and clubs.
Expect around €10 for an aperitivo, €12 to €20 for cocktails at top bars, and an entry fee at many clubs, sometimes including a drink.
Rome has several world-class spots, including Drink Kong in Monti, a regular on The World’s 50 Best Bars. See our guide to the best bars in Rome.
The main clubbing areas are Testaccio, Ostiense and the centre. See our guide to the best clubs in Rome.
Aperitivo is a Roman ritual of a drink with snacks before dinner, from around 6.30 to 8.30pm. See our guide to the best aperitivo in Rome.
Rome has a rich live scene, from jazz and blues clubs to rock and indie venues.
Rome’s enoteche range from historic spots to modern natural-wine bars, spread across Monti, the centre and Trastevere. See our Rome wine bar guide.
Smart casual works almost everywhere. Upscale rooftops and clubs may expect a dressier look, while Trastevere and San Lorenzo stay relaxed.
Rome is generally safe at night in the central nightlife areas. Keep an eye on your belongings in crowded spots, and note that public transport runs until around 1am, with night buses after.
